Understanding Histamine Intolerance

Histamine is a natural compound that serves multiple functions in the body, acting as a neurotransmitter and playing a significant part in the immune system’s response to foreign substances or injury. It is stored within mast cells and basophils, and its release causes the familiar symptoms associated with allergic reactions, such as inflammation and itching. The body naturally manages histamine levels through specific enzymes that break it down.

Histamine intolerance (HI) occurs when there is an imbalance between the amount of histamine consumed or released internally and the body’s capacity to break it down. The primary enzyme responsible for degrading histamine ingested through food is Diamine Oxidase (DAO), which is mainly produced in the intestinal lining. If the activity of the DAO enzyme is insufficient, the histamine absorbed from the digestive tract can accumulate in the bloodstream, exceeding the individual’s tolerance threshold.

The symptoms of histamine intolerance are varied and can mimic those of an allergy, often affecting multiple systems in the body. Common manifestations include headaches, migraines, skin issues like hives or itching, and digestive upset such as abdominal pain or diarrhea. Symptoms can also involve the cardiovascular system (irregular heartbeats or blood pressure fluctuations) or the respiratory system (nasal congestion or wheezing).

Why Fermentation Increases Histamine Content

Sour cream is considered a food with elevated histamine levels, and the reason is directly linked to its production method. Unlike fresh cream, sour cream undergoes a controlled process of fermentation. This process involves the introduction of specific bacterial cultures, typically lactic acid bacteria, which are responsible for thickening the cream and giving it its characteristic tangy flavor.

These lactic acid bacteria possess a specific enzyme called histidine decarboxylase. This enzyme acts upon the amino acid histidine, which is naturally present in the dairy protein, converting it into histamine. The chemical reaction involves the removal of a carboxyl group from the histidine molecule, resulting in the formation of histamine, which raises the histamine content of the final product.

The concentration of histamine in the finished sour cream can vary based on several factors, including the specific strains of bacteria used in the culture, the temperature of the fermentation, and the duration of the aging process. Generally, all fermented dairy products, including yogurt and aged cheeses, contain higher levels of biogenic amines compared to their fresh counterparts like pasteurized milk. The longer the bacteria are active and the longer the product is stored, the greater the potential for histamine accumulation.

Dairy Alternatives for a Low-Histamine Diet

Since sour cream is a fermented product, it is typically restricted or avoided on a low-histamine diet. The general principle for managing dairy in this context is that freshness is the main determinant of low histamine content. Fresh, unfermented dairy products, such as pasteurized milk, butter, and cream, are usually tolerated better because they have not undergone the microbial conversion of histidine into histamine.

Specific types of cheese, such as fresh ricotta or cottage cheese that is not made with cultures, are generally considered lower in histamine than aged or hard cheeses like cheddar or Parmesan. When considering dairy-based substitutes for sour cream, alternatives like fresh cottage cheese blended with a small amount of milk and white vinegar can mimic the texture and tanginess without the histamine-producing fermentation.

For a non-dairy substitution that replicates the creamy texture of sour cream, options that have not been fermented are the best choice. Coconut cream can serve as a base for a low-histamine topping when combined with an acid like lemon juice or white vinegar to achieve a similar tartness. Plant-based creams made from rice or certain non-fermented nuts may also be used. When selecting any substitute, check the ingredient list for other fermented items or highly processed additives.
